DJ Qness, born Qhubani Ndlovu is probably one of South Africa's most relevant and prominent DJ/Producer figures. With a gold-selling debut album, Qness has done production work and remixed for artists such as M.I.A on the single "XXXO" and done work for Kele from Bloc Party.
He is C.E.O of Qness Communications, which also makes him one of the few DJ figures that know how to run a business that supports their DJ and production talent. Other prominent names he has worked with on the dance scene include Tel Aviv's Avi Elman (aka UPZ), Bhoddi Satva from Belgium and Carlos Mena, who is based in Miami.
His musical style switches between deep house, African tribal and electro-pop, which he has been exposed to while working with international artists. Qness is definitely a force to reckon with in the DJ scene, not only in South Africa and Africa, but across the world!
